I think there is some truth to the idea that Dak doesn’t always see the whole field and has some accuracy issues. On the flip side he’s a great ball handler and makes good decisions on what he does see.

He’s great selling the hand off and play action and rarely throws to a guy that isn’t open but I see him fixate on 1-2 guys too often missing a lot of open guys that a QB like Rodgers wouldn’t, and he does not always put the ball where it needs to be....right throw, but poorly placed.

He’s a work in progress but IMO has the tools. Most of his problems I think are to do with reading the field and finesse throws. Two things that take time IMO.
